The Developer Portal

This portal is for developers contributing to FlightGear. If you wanna help with FlightGears development, it's a good idea to subscribe yourself to the FlightGear devel mailing list. The list archive is also available and should be searched before posting the same question.

The FlightGear project is looking for organizations/individuals who would be willing to help sponsor a fulltime project coordinator/manager to help oversee the overall development process If you are interested in helping or have anything else to contribute to this issue, please subscribe to the the FlightGear Devel mailing list to discuss details.

RFC Topics

Clarification:In its current form, the RFC section is exclusively based on and covered by previous mailing list and forum discussions (as well as various wiki entries), as such it is not supposed to reflect work in progress (RFC="Request For Comments" and not WIP), but is rather to be seen as an attempt to provide comprehensive analyses and summaries of key issues identified in various FlightGear related discussions and feature requests (which are to be linked to in the corresponding resource sections, if that didn't yet take place, it's because of most of these RFCs being indeed WIP).

Thus, RFC entries are not meant to imply anyone "working" on any of these issues, in fact only because an RFC entry is listed here doesn't necessarily mean that work on that particular issue is endorsed by the FlightGear community.
